[[{"type":"media","view_mode":"media_large","fid":"706","attributes":{"alt":"","class":"media-image","height":"480","style":"width: 100px; float: left; height: 133px; margin-left: 10px; margin-right: 10px;","typeof":"foaf:Image","width":"360"}}]]Congratulations to Suhasa Kodandaramaiah, PhD ME '13, for being named in Forbes.com 30 Under 30 list. As a grad student at Tech, Kodandaramaiah spends his time creating robots that can measure electrical potentials and genetic changes in brain cells more efficiently than a human scientist. He and professors Craig Forest and Ed Boyden started a company called Neuromatic Devices to commercialize the robots.
